Transaction 809031ba164bd8b44be86e4dea23f9fdabf0341b4dcb95592233632f4b666047
1 Input
1 Output
-
809031ba164bd8b44be86e4dea23f9fdabf0341b4dcb95592233632f4b666047: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18042440e3cc33606eaf467f79e14ac04778ec22 OP_EQUAL
- address
- 33t16urioxyqQBxRKPXX3CWqt9PerQPydL